Conflicts and Identity: A Historical Perspective

This chapter contrasts the American Civil War and World War I, exploring their roles in shaping American identity and public sentiment. It examines the complexities surrounding the U.S. entry into World War I, the dynamics at the Paris Peace Conference, and the emergence of Hitler amidst the global repercussions of these conflicts. Ultimately, it discusses how historical narratives are influenced by various factors, including leadership, societal currents, and the implications of peace treaties.
